YX08 CTO is a 2008 Renault Scenic in Blue with a 1,598c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 16 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 68.8%.
Across all 2008 Renault Scenic models, the average MOT pass rate is 68.9% with a typical mileage of 62,591 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Renault Scenic f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 108,325 recorded failures. If you're considering buying YX08 CTO,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Renault Scenic typically stays on UK roads for around 26 years. At 18 years old, this Renault Scenic is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
